Key Responsibilities & Duties
- Prepare detailed cost estimates for diverse construction projects, ensuring accuracy and competitiveness.
- Collaborate with project managers, engineers, and architects to gather necessary data.
- Analyze project specifications, drawings, and contracts to determine costs.
- Monitor market trends and pricing to provide updated cost assessments.
- Assist in bid preparation and submission for new projects.
- Maintain detailed records of estimates and project costs for future reference.
- Participate in project planning and budgeting meetings.
- Ensure compliance with industry standards and regulations in cost estimation.
